The anisotropic ESR spectra of the CFsX-radical anions (X = Cl, Br, I) have been observed following 7 irradiation at 77 K of solid solutions containing up to 5 mole % of the CF3X parent compound in tetramethylsilane (TMS), neopentane, and 2-methyltetrahydrofuran.
